Examine Your Home's Build
When assessing the best exterior cladding, homeowners must first assess their home's architecture to ensure a harmonious blend of style and functionality. Each architectural style—be it colonial, modern, or craftsman—has distinct characteristics that determine suitable siding options. For example, traditional homes may work well with classic wood or vinyl siding, while contemporary designs often complement metal or fiber cement materials. It is essential to take into account the scale, texture, and color of the siding, making sure it matches architectural elements such as rooflines, windows, and doors. Additionally, regional influences and climate should inform the choice, as certain materials function more effectively under specific weather conditions. Ultimately, selecting siding that improves architectural integrity will boost the overall aesthetic and value of the home.
Review Your Spending Options
Understanding the architectural style of a home provides the groundwork for picking suitable siding, but budget factors play a vital role in the decision-making process. Homeowners should first establish a specific budget, accounting for labor costs, care, and potential future repairs. Various siding options, such as vinyl, wood, and fiber cement, come with different price points and longevity. Vinyl siding gives cost savings and easy maintenance, while wood delivers aesthetic charm but needs more maintenance. Fiber cement strikes a balance between durability and expense, making it an increasingly popular choice. Ultimately, evaluating both design preferences and financial limits will direct homeowners toward picking the best siding material that enhances their home's curb appeal without jeopardizing financial comfort.

Maintenance Tips for Keeping Your Siding Looking Great
Preserving siding requires consistent attention to guarantee it stays attractive and operational. Homeowners should start by performing seasonal assessments to identify any signs of deterioration, such as fractures or bending. Cleaning the siding at least two times annually with a mild soap and water is essential to remove fungal growth, discoloration, and grime, which can degrade the material over time.
Moreover, it is wise to cut down vegetation that may touch the siding, as this can lead to water accumulation and pest infestation. For vinyl or aluminum siding, using a sealant on a regular basis can improve durability and shine. When repainting wood siding, applying high-quality exterior paint will preserve its integrity against natural conditions. Finally, handling small maintenance issues without delay can avoid major deterioration, keeping the siding remains an appealing feature of the home. Routine maintenance not only boosts visual appeal but also extends the longevity of the siding.

What Are the Ecological Impacts of Different Exterior Wall Materials?
Different exterior cladding options have varying ecological consequences. Wood can cause deforestation, vinyl may emit harmful chemicals, while fiber cement is more eco-friendly due to its durability and lower resource consumption throughout its lifespan.
How Often Should I Swap Out My Siding?
Siding typically needs updating every 20 to 40 years, contingent on material quality and care. Regular evaluations can assist in establishing the appropriate timing for replacement, making certain the home stays protected and visually pleasing.

What Warranties Are Offered for Siding Options?
Various warranties are available for siding products, including manufacturer's warranties, which typically cover defects, and labor warranties from installation companies. Duration and coverage details vary, so examining specific terms before purchase is crucial for homeowners.
